Posted: March 27, 2020 Job title: Perl Developer / Sustainer Company name: Masters Traditional Games Location: St. Albans, UK Pay rate: £35K Terms of employment: Salaried employee Hours: Flexible Onsite: some Description: For the last 20 years, I have created in Perl a website shop, product and inventory management system, order processing and stock ordering system plus. But I am not a developer - I am the owner of a company that now has 4 employees and turns over £1.5million pa. I need someone to start as a Perl sidekick who will grow to take over much of the Perl work that I do. Initial Project – Set up a Straightforward Perl Development Environment Thereafter - sustain and fix bugs, some urgent, in the existing system. Gradually migrate the existing system to better ways of doing things. And write some new features as they become required. Some sysadmin work may also need doing. You will need to live with some pretty peculiar coding that I've left behind me over the years. It's vital that you are able to understand other people's code and are able to make fixes without complete rewrites (most of the time). All manner of stuff comes up - you may need to be involved with product feeds into Amazon, fixing email relays identifying a memory leak or lifting a skittles table into position at any point! I am willing to be flexible to get the right person. Part-time, flexible hours, remote working, contract or permanent as desired. But visits to the office will be necessary - probably every day to begin with and then we'll have to see what works. Desired skills: * Perl or maybe not if you are already a coder and have a willingness to learn Perl. * MySQL or an understanding of relational databases. * Caution * We are a Windows shop with hints of Linux.
